Oakland bookstore is selling off 5,000 cookbooks, including rare and historic titles
Briefly

The Bookmark Bookstore, located in downtown Oakland, will soon hold a significant sale featuring over 5,000 cookbooks, with funds supporting the Oakland Public Library. The collection includes rare and vintage titles, dating back to World War II and beyond. Operations manager Erin Rivero notes the excitement of unearthing older cookbooks while highlighting a diverse range of cooking styles present in the sale. Since its founding in 1992, The Bookmark has donated over $3 million to the library, emphasizing its community focus and volunteer efforts.
"We're still digging through items that are on the older side. We've found titles dating back to the 1940s, and we imagine there are even older items in the collection."
"The March sale spans many cuisines and specialties from culinary masters around the globe. There are many niche and oddball titles for sale."
